A MAN was smashed over the head with a metal bar in a seemingly unprovoked street attack.

The 25-year-old victim was struck with the terrifying weapon in Rixon Street, Holloway, at 2am on Saturday (January 8).

Two men then set upon him in a crazed assault that only ended when he managed ro escape their grasp and flee to safety.

A spokeswoman for Islington police said: “The victim said he was in Rixon Street when a man emerged from an address and struck him over the head with a metal bar in an unprovoked assault.

“He tried to ward off the blows and was struck on his arm and fingers. A second man appeared and also attacked him, punching him in the head a number of times. The victim managed to break free and was again struck on the back with the metal bar as he ran away.”

The victim was taken to hospital for treatment to fractured fingers and injuries to his head and lower back.
